July in the vegetable garden is in the main a month of upkeep : watering , applying additional mulch , weeding , and harvest . The challenging nurseryman may take on extra tasks , such as sequential planting of select vegetable , and planning and preparing for the planting of gloaming crop .
July is a dear month for filling in empty spaces left from those early - spent springtime crop such as lettuce , English peas , potatoes , and radish . July planting may include beans and squash and a master of ceremonies of other vegetables . weed
It ’s important to operate weeds around vegetables because weeds will out - contend veggie plants for nutrients , body of water , and sunlight . The best method to control weeds is by mechanical extraction , meaning good old - fashioned gage - pulling or the use of a hoe . For pocket-sized pot , the “ hoop ” or “ stirrup ” hoeis extremely recommend because it allows for shallow cultivation . Another plus for the basket hoe : it does n’t convey mourning band seeds to the Earth’s surface of the grease ! Many pot seeds require sunlight to spud , so deep refinement or utilizing a tiller often brings seeds to the surface of the territory , facilitate seed germination for a new crop of undesirable weeds .
More Tips and Tasks for July :
Continue to supervise water moisture levels around plants . The rule of thumb is that plants ask one column inch of piddle per hebdomad to maintain productiveness . Mulching reduces the indigence for frequent watering and improves yields . Early morning is the best fourth dimension to water . Evening watering is less worthy because parting that remain wet through the dark are more susceptible to fungal diseases .
